On Tuesday 2 July Prime Minister Narendra Modi recently addressed the Lok Sabha in response to the Motion of Thanks on the President’s address. Despite opposition sloganeering, he highlighted several key points:

  1. Mandate of the People: PM Modi acknowledged that the public’s mandate during the world’s largest election campaign was in favor of his government. He emphasized the defeat of those who spread continuous lies.

  2. Resolve for ‘Viksit Bharat’: President Murmu’s address underscored the government’s commitment to building a developed India (‘Viksit Bharat’) and addressing critical issues.

  3. Anti-Corruption Stance: The government’s zero tolerance against corruption received widespread support. Their guiding principle has been ‘India first.’

  4. Balancing Justice and Appeasement: PM Modi emphasized justice for all and rejected appeasement politics. The focus has been on ‘santushtikaran’ (contentment) rather than ‘tushtikaran’ (appeasement).

  5. Transformational Era: The country emerged from despair in 2014, electing the government that initiated an era of transformation.

Despite the challenges, PM Modi assured tireless efforts to fulfill the resolve for a prosperous India. The speech reflected the government’s commitment to progress and inclusivity.
